For many, communication relies on spoken language. This conventional method can limit interactions for individuals with speech impairments. Until now, these individuals faced barriers in expressing their thoughts and needs.
A team of researchers has introduced a groundbreaking wearable AI sensor. This device interprets subtle neck movements to translate silent speech into audible voice. The innovation aims to transform how we understand and facilitate communication.
Initial testing showed promising results. Participants were able to convey complex sentences without vocalizing them, thanks to the sensor’s accuracy. Research teams noted a significant improvement in user engagement during trials.
The implications are vast. This technology can empower those with disabilities, enhancing their ability to interact in various settings. As the technology matures, it could redefine communication norms for everyone.
